Is there a trick to removing a sofa/bed and installing theater seats or recliners without taking it to dealer? The entry door seems pretty small to tackle this on our own, but I feel people do it all the time. Any suggestions/tips? Thank you!
 
The back usually comes off on a lot of them.
What do you have that you're trying to get it out of?
Put the make, model, and year of your camper in your signature. It will help with getting answers.
 
DebiE, I just replaced our sofa-bed (tri fold sofa-bed), it came apart in three pieces, plus the two arm rests. Not a hard job if your handy, pieces are kind of heavy may need help to move. Replaced with RecPro double wall hugger recliner sofa. :thumb:
